Two independent zones from one faucet The Eden 93412 2-Zone Digital Programmable Water Timer lets you manage two separate watering areas from a single spigot. Each valve works like its own timer, making it easy to tailor irrigation for lawns, gardens, or planters without swapping hardware. Each valve functions as a separate timer for different zones Simple installation and intuitive controls with a large angled LCD display Raised buttons provide comfortable typing while you program Flexible scheduling that fits real life Choose specific days of the week, every few days, or water on demand Set precise start times and durations for each zone Water cycle lengths range from 1 minute up to 6 hours Manual watering lets you water on demand for quick tasks like washing a car Rain delay pauses watering when rain is forecast, helping conserve water Smart pairing and practical versatility Pair the Eden timer with the Eden Wireless Soil Moisture Sensor (sold separately) to monitor soil moisture and help prevent overwatering.
